UK events

UK Events

UK Events information and tickets bookings

Entertainments Search:

  1. UK Information
  2. UK Events
  3. Shipston-on-Stour Events
  4. Townsend Hall

Townsend Hall

Townsend Hall,Shipston-on-Stour Address
map
Townsend Hall
Sheep Street
Shipston on Stour
CV36 4AE
Map and Directions
Townsend Hall,Shipston-on-Stour Telephone No.
07800 771368